Italy’s FTSE MIB Borsa Italiana Closed Up 23% in 2021

The Italian Blue Chip stock index, the FTSE MIB closed unchanged at 27,346.83 on the last trading day of the year, up 23% for 2021. It was the second sharpest yearly rise since 2009, after falling 5.4% to 22,233 in 2020. Italy’s FTSE MIB Borsa Italiana Closed Down 5.4% in 2020 Among Lockdown Nerves

The Italian Blue Chip stock index the FTSE MIB fell 5.4% to 22,233 in 2020 bouncing back from lows in March after Italy was the first western country to implement a national lockdown, Italy’s FTSE MIB index crashed to a nearly eight-year low of 14,153.  Concerns about the impact of current restrictive measures on Italy’s fragile economy overhang sentiment.
